About Mike Gardiner:
Mike Gardiner (full name: Michael James Gardiner; no nicknames) played pitcher from 1990 until 1995 for the Seattle Mariners, Boston Red Sox, Montreal Expos and Detroit Tigers. He played for the Mariners in 1990, Red Sox from 1991 - 1992, Expos in 1993 and Tigers from 1993 - 1995. Over 6 seasons, he started 46 games, won 17 games, struck out 239 batters, and had a 5.21 ERA. Born on October 19, 1965 in Sarnia, Ontario, CAN, Gardiner stands 6' 0" and weighs 185 lb. He attended high school and was drafted by the Seattle Mariners in the 18th round of the 1987 amateur draft. His debut was on September 8, 1990 and he played his final game on July 2, 1995. Over his career, Gardiner made $601,000.
